Netscape update confirmed

p2pnet.net News:- "Written off for dead about a year ago, the forefather of Web browsers, Netscape Navigator, is being resuscitated in the coming months with an updated version," said an eWeek story last May, going on, "But whether it will mark a revival of the browser, or simply some life support, remains to be seen."

It’d be the first update, "since AOL spun off its Mozilla open-source development group last July, weeks after releasing its last Netscape Navigator, Version 7.1," says the report, which also points out that a new Netscape would kill speculation that AOL would end Netscape browser releases.

"Along with spinning off Mozilla last year, Netscape also had laid off most of its developers and programmers, former Netscape employees said," according to eWeek.

However, 7.2 CD ships August 3, says Netscape here. "Purchase Netscape software and guides to install the full Netscape suite on your computer or across your entire enterprise. Our guidebook offers step-by-step instructions on how to use your software."
